Transaction e2c3367589f1285acbd9319c66c1c5bb73ab4c506eaf21b7e32ee9f69241d142

1 Input
2 Outputs
  • e2c3367589f1285acbd9319c66c1c5bb73ab4c506eaf21b7e32ee9f69241d142:0
  • value  16528557
    address  3HW1zEnb4LnTSS1PtVJazZZrN5Z5aZJ3HW
  • e2c3367589f1285acbd9319c66c1c5bb73ab4c506eaf21b7e32ee9f69241d142:1
  • value  1529540
    address  33gZQysphngkqrTq8MMUknzVhRxqiCgfCN